Job DescriptionPega Lead Business Architect will act as a liaison between the business users, stakeholders and technologists. This individual will be responsible to work with Lead System Architect and Leadership team jointly charting business and technical strategies. This position will have the opportunity to exercise a variety of skill sets while participating in software development and systems integration projects for a wide variety of users and stakeholders.
The ideal candidate will have a strong background in requirements gathering, tracking, and analysis with an ability to communicate the information to both technical and non-technical professionals. The primary function of this position will involve the evaluation of user needs and development and implementation of technological solutions to solve those needs.
